Discovery learning has been a buzzword for a while now. The discovery learning method gives athletic training students the freedom to ask their own questions, do their own research, solve problems, and come to their own conclusions.

Athletic training students can think outside the box when they step away from traditional learning methods. By discovering new information and exploring different objects, learning becomes a dynamic and never-ending process. As a result, athletic training students will be equipped to interact with the world around them more deeply and remember concepts better.

Incorporating Discovery Learning

Almost any class can use discovery learning. Since it includes so many methods, it can be used whenever it’s needed. Discovery learning can be used to teach an entire subject. Discovery learning is praised by both professors and students, and with so many benefits, it’s really only going to get more popular.

Incorporating discovery learning is easy because it doesn’t take too much time or work. It’s a flexible idea with one goal: creating more interactive classrooms.
